Memo — Gross-Margin Review

Hi all,

Quick word on the half-year margin review for the Fennick product lines. Short version: margins slipped about two points, mostly freight and packaging costs out of the Aldermere plant. The good news — the reformulated Fennick Pro line is tracking above target, and supplier renegotiations start next month. Branch managers, please flag any local discounting beyond standard bands. Context on where we're headed is below.

internal memo for kawip-hadug: Headcount on the Wenwyn team goes from 7 to 140 by the end of January. Gross margin on Wenwyn came in at 20 percent against a plan of 15 percent.

# Vexley Assignment Service — Limits & Quotas

Vexley assigns A/B buckets for all Cardamine apps. Hard limits: 500 active experiments per workspace, 40 variants per experiment, 2k assignment requests/sec per client key. Exceeding the rate limit returns a retryable throttle response; clients should back off. Quota bumps go through the platform review queue, not ad hoc config edits. Current enforcement constants, as deployed to production, are listed below.

tuning table, faduf-baduf:
PRIORITIES = {
    "ulavan": 191,
    "silys": 750,
    "goriel": 238,
    "kelmir": 66,
    "wendor": 432,
}

**Q: What's going on with the Pelloway query planner regression?**

Short version for the sync: after the 4.2 upgrade, the planner started picking nested-loop joins on the invoices fanout, and p95 latency tripled on the Drennish cluster. We've pinned the old statistics profile as a stopgap, and Marisol is bisecting the cost-model change. Don't re-enable adaptive plans until her ticket closes. If you need to inspect the pinned profile, the stats vault opens with the recovery passphrase below.

recovery phrase for fajep-yaweg: gilath-sorox-wenius-rusdor-keliel-zorius